My fiancee and I have decided to get married in Punta Cana this November. Unfortunately, I don't travel well. I am very worried about getting sick. I have been to Cancun before and was very cautious about the food/water. But, I have heard MANY cases of illness in the DR. Why is this?

Second question. We will be staying at the RIU Bambu and I was wondering if anyone had stayed there. Also was wondering if there is a medical facility there and if it is American or Canadian.

Don't worry, Think about the Wonderful Wedding

Tersh, don't get yourself too concerned about the food or water. The food is good. Just take reasonable precautions. Water, drink bottled water. I'm sure the other posters will come up with more advice and please check the DR1 archives for more information about this matter.

Most of the hotels and resorts have doctors on site or on call. Also, there is a brand new private hospital in Punta Cana, only five minutes from the airport. I believe the name of the place is Hospiten. There is Spanish/English/French/German/Italian speaking staff. Regards, PJT
